using namespace cv;
using namespace std;
void Sharpen(const Mat& myImage, Mat& Result)
{
CV_Assert(myImage.depth() == CV_8U); // accept only uchar images
Result.create(myImage.size(), myImage.type());
const int nChannels = myImage.channels();
for(int j = 1; j < myImage.rows - 1; ++j)
{
const uchar* previous = myImage.ptr(j - 1);
const uchar* current = myImage.ptr(j );
const uchar* next = myImage.ptr(j + 1);
uchar* output = Result.ptr(j);
for(int i = nChannels; i < nChannels * (myImage.cols - 1); ++i)
{
*output++ = saturate_cast(5 * current[i]
-current[i - nChannels] - current[i + nChannels] - previous[i] - next[i]);
}
}
Result.row(0).setTo(Scalar(0));
Result.row(Result.rows - 1).setTo(Scalar(0));
Result.col(0).setTo(Scalar(0));
Result.col(Result.cols - 1).setTo(Scalar(0));
}
